If the books are all epubs and if they all came from the calibre library that you will connect to then you don't need to resend them. Instead let CC scan the library on connect. It will send the metadata to calibre, go through book matching, then get the latest metadata back from calibre.
If the books are not epubs then it is much faster to resend them.
Sure. See our FAQ answer Can I synchronize CC's Read and Date Read information with calibre?. Note that you must connect once as a wireless device so CC can get the names of the custom columns to show you in its setup. After you set things up the values will sync on the next wireless device connect.
